Neighborhood Overview
Schenley Park is centrally located in Pittsburgh, nestled within the Oakland neighborhood, a hub for education and culture. It’s easily accessible from major thoroughfares like the Parkway East (I-376) and Schenley Drive. Parking within the park can be a challenge, especially on event days, with main lots located near the main facilities and sports fields. Pittsburgh International Airport (PIT) is approximately a 30-45 minute drive away, depending on traffic. Public transportation options are available, with numerous bus routes serving the Oakland area, providing convenient access to and from the park. For those arriving by rideshare, drop-off points are typically designated near the park’s main entrances. Smart arrival tactics include checking for event schedules to anticipate crowds and planning to arrive at least 30-45 minutes before your scheduled activity to secure parking and allow time for check-in.

Things to Do
Walkable
Phipps Conservatory and Botanical Gardens
On siteStep into a world of breathtaking botanical beauty at Phipps Conservatory. This iconic landmark, located within Schenley Park, features stunning glasshouses filled with diverse plant collections, seasonal flower shows, and immersive exhibits. It’s a perfect place for a quiet stroll, photography, or simply to escape into nature’s tranquility between games or events. The conservatory offers a peaceful respite, showcasing a variety of themed rooms that change throughout the year, providing a unique experience with each visit. Allow at least an hour to explore its enchanting displays.
Schenley Park Golf Course
On siteChallenge your foursome or enjoy a casual round at the Schenley Park Golf Course. This public 9-hole course offers a welcoming environment for golfers of all skill levels, set against the backdrop of the park’s natural beauty. With its rolling hills and mature trees, it provides a scenic and enjoyable golfing experience right within the park. The course is known for its accessibility and well-maintained greens, making it a convenient option for those looking to practice their swing or enjoy a leisurely afternoon of golf. Reservations are often recommended, especially during peak times.
5–15 Minutes Away
Carnegie Museums of Pittsburgh
0.8 miExplore world-class art and natural history at the Carnegie Museums of Pittsburgh, located just a short distance from Schenley Park in the Oakland neighborhood. The complex comprises four distinct museums: the Carnegie Museum of Art, Carnegie Museum of Natural History, Carnegie Science Center, and The Andy Warhol Museum. Visitors can immerse themselves in diverse exhibitions, from ancient artifacts and dinosaur skeletons to modern art and scientific discoveries. It’s an ideal destination for educational outings, rainy-day activities, or cultural enrichment for the whole family.
University of Pittsburgh
0.7 miExperience the vibrant atmosphere of the University of Pittsburgh's main campus, situated adjacent to Schenley Park. The historic Cathedral of Learning, an iconic Gothic-style skyscraper, offers breathtaking views from its Nationality Rooms on the 42nd floor, providing a unique cultural and historical perspective. Walking through the campus allows you to appreciate its blend of historic architecture and modern facilities, soaking in the energy of a major academic institution. It's a pleasant area for a post-game stroll or to discover local eateries catering to students and faculty.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Pittsburgh brings cold temperatures, often hovering around freezing, with a chance of snow. Visitors should pack warm layers, including hats, gloves, and waterproof outerwear. Outdoor activities can be limited by the chill, so shorter durations or indoor options are advisable. Dress warmly for travel to and from the park, and be prepared for potentially slick surfaces if snow or ice is present.
Spring & early summer
Spring weather is generally mild and pleasant, with temperatures gradually warming into the 60s and 70s Fahrenheit. Early summer continues this trend, offering comfortable conditions ideal for outdoor sports and recreation. Light jackets or sweaters may be useful for cooler mornings and evenings. This is a prime time for park visits, with green spaces in full bloom, though occasional rain showers are possible.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er (July-August) brings warm to hot and humid conditions, with daytime temperatures frequently reaching the 80s and sometimes 90s. Hydration is crucial, and sunscreen is highly recommended for extended periods outdoors. Light, breathable clothing is best. While perfect for active play, be mindful of the heat, especially during peak daylight hours, and seek shade during breaks.
Fall season
Fall offers crisp, cool air, with temperatures typically ranging from the 50s to 70s Fahrenheit in early fall, gradually dropping as the season progresses. This is a picturesque time in Schenley Park, with beautiful autumn foliage. Pack layers, including sweaters and light jackets, as mornings and evenings can be cool. It's an excellent season for enjoying the park's beauty and outdoor activities comfortably.
Rain & snow
Pittsburgh experiences a moderate amount of rainfall throughout the year, with heavier periods possible in spring and summer. Snowfall is common in winter, though accumulations can vary. When rain or snow is expected, pack waterproof gear, including umbrellas and water-resistant footwear. Events may proceed in light precipitation, but heavy weather can lead to cancellations or delays, so always check event status if conditions are severe.
